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95897514 12057941426 83656
3883 64016902
3883 64016902
258 8473852570 66
All about undefined
Interested in learning more?
3883 64016902
258 8473852570 66
See more
5140 660854353 86
16024602930 872059232 616 000
See more
2127381127 09628
5838 14956533291 118255708
See more